The first step is to clarify the large classification of net products.

the first sort
HEPA filter type
HEPA – Abbreviation for High-Efficiency Particulate Air Filter, which means a high-efficiency air filter. When filtered with HEPA, the air can pass completely, but fine particles in the air are quickly intercepted.

Achieving HEPA standards means that this filter is effective at intercepting 0.3-micron particles at least 99.99%. By using HEPA combined with activated carbon to make a composite filter, it is possible to simultaneously adsorb particulate matter and formaldehyde gas.

H14 HEPA filter used by Miwei

Of course, some manufacturers will add sterilizing cloth, primary filter, negative ion, cold catalyst, ultraviolet lamp, etc. to assist in purification in order to increase product function. However, all purification is mainly based on HEPA filters and activated carbon. Therefore, 90% of manufacturers have chosen this purification method.

in conclusion
Advantages: mature technology, high purification efficiency, high CADR value of formaldehyde and particulate matter.
Disadvantages: The filter needs to be replaced regularly, and the wind resistance will generate noise.

The second type of electrostatic dust collection
The high-pressure discharge allows the particles to be charged, and the built-in dust box releases the opposite-charge to absorb the particles. For the principle, please read the third-grade physics textbook. Purification of formaldehyde is also the oxidative decomposition of formaldehyde molecules by ion discharge

in conclusion
Advantages: no need to replace consumables, but regular high-frequency cleaning.
Disadvantages: It can remove the dust, can not remove the poisonous gas, the efficiency is lower than the mechanical type, slow, easy to produce ozone, and is rated as the worst purifier by the US market.

Today, everyone knows that winter should be protected from smog, but it ignores the summer TVOC. The so-called “TVOC” refers to indoor organic gaseous substances, also known as total volatile organic compounds, including benzenes, alkanes, aromatics, alkenes, halocarbons, esters, aldehydes, ketones, etc. Toxic and harmful gases in the air. There are many sources of pollution indoors, which are the same in both winter and summer. Especially in summer, the temperature is high, and these harmful substances are more serious in the room.
The release of indoor pollution such as formaldehyde is greatly affected by temperature, and the indoor and outdoor temperatures are high in summer, so it is easy to cause indoor pollutant concentration to exceed the standard. For every 1 °C rise in room temperature, formaldehyde volatilized from wooden furniture and flooring will increase the concentration of formaldehyde in the air by 0.15 to 0.37 times. Therefore, the volatilization of paint flavors such as benzene and ammonia is more serious in summer than in winter, and radioactive cesium is often contained in household tiles. This serious carcinogenic gas also spreads with increasing temperature.

So the air purifier can purify those pollutants? First, we must first know what pollutants are in the indoor air. According to the US Environmental Protection Agency, there are about 400 kinds of pollutants in indoor air, but they are roughly divided into Chemical pollutants such as formaldehyde, benzene, TVOC; microbial contaminants such as bacteria, viruses, insects, and particulate pollutants such as dust and pollen.

As a device that can continuously improve the indoor air quality, the air purifier must be able to purify the above three types of pollutants. But in fact, the effect of many air purifiers is far from being achieved! This is because we have a large demand for air purifiers because of smog, so many air purifier manufacturers are purifying them in order to seize consumers. In terms of ability, it tends to move closer to pollutants such as dust and particulate matter.

However, as far as our current indoor air pollution is concerned, chemical pollutants such as formaldehyde, benzene, and TVOC are particularly harmful to us, and it is also the main indoor pollutant at present. The main source is decoration residue. So how does the air purifier clean up the chemical pollutants left by these decorations?

At present, the conventional air purifier on the market is convenient for pollutants such as formaldehyde, and an activated carbon filter is usually used for adsorption. Although activated carbon has a certain ability to adsorb formaldehyde, its drawbacks are also very obvious. According to the research, in ordinary households, the ordinary activated carbon filter will generally be saturated for about 2-3 months, and after saturation, the formaldehyde will be re-emitted into the air, causing secondary pollution. On July 20 this year, the Ministry of the Environment of the Republic of Korea broke out that OIT (octylisothiazolinone), which is harmful to the human body, was detected in the air purifiers and air-conditioning filters on the Korean market. OIT-containing products cover most of the brands on the market, with up to 84 models.

What is OIT? OIT is an antibacterial, mildew-resistant, oil-soluble chemical. On some filter screens marked with “sterilization” type purifiers, manufacturers use OIT, an anti-fungal agent to sterilize and prevent the strainer from becoming moldy. However, this chemical is harmful to the human body, it is highly toxic to aquatic organisms, and causes an allergic reaction in the human body in direct contact or through the air. The anti-mold agent component enters the human body together with the exhaust of the purifier and the air conditioner.

The Korean Ministry of the Environment has conducted a risk assessment and believes that OIT, an antimicrobial ingredient, poses a potential risk to human health. For public health reasons, the Korean Ministry of the Environment has asked major manufacturers to recall all air purifier filters containing OIT components.

According to a report by South Korea’s International Broadcasting Station (KBS) on July 22, the list of 84 air purifiers and air conditioners containing the toxic substance OIT announced by the Ministry of Environment of the Republic of Korea, some of Samsung Electronics, LG Electronics, Cuckoo, and other companies. The product is impressively listed.

The filters of these companies are produced by two international brands.

Subsequently, 3M apologized for the detection of toxic substances in the air purifier filter and immediately began recalling the product.

At present, with the continuous promotion of formaldehyde removal products and the increase in demand for new housing, air purifier products with formaldehyde screen display will further increase. At present, in the aspect of formaldehyde detection, the mainstream sensor application is an electrochemical sensor, and the mainstream application of dust detection is a laser particle sensor. Other detection contents include VOC correlation, temperature, humidity, and the like.
